ujoinautoparts

Cheap auto engine parts water pump for Daihatsu 16100-87787 16100-87796 for Charade II G11 G30 1.0L G11 CB22 CB20 83-85

  • USD $10 - $100 / Piece
  • 1 Piece / Pieces